R v Kirby; Ex parte Boilermakers' Society of Australia
[1956] HCA 10; (1956) 94 CLR 254 (affd sub nom Attorney-General (Cth) v The Queen [1957] AC 288; (1957) 95 CLR 529, PC)
Key Principle
Under Chapter III of the Constitution, the judicial power of the Commonwealth may be vested only in courts, and a body exercising federal judicial power cannot also be invested with non-judicial functions.
